'Cats Clinch 4-3 Victory Over Rice
1/28/2024 5:50:00 PM | Women's Tennis
COLLEGE STATION, Texas - Northwestern women's tennis improved to 4-1 on the season Sunday with a victory over Rice in their second of two matches at the ITA Kickoff weekend in College Station, Texas.
The duo of Maria Shusharina and Britany Lau blanked their opponents 6-0 to start off doubles action. Sydney Pratt and Elisa Van Meeteren followed with a 6-4 victory at the #2 position to secure the doubles point for the Wildcats.
Christina Hand put the 'Cats out to a 2-0 lead from the #3 singles position, notching a 6-2, 6-3 win for her fourth individual victory of the season. Rice then picked up a pair of singles victories themselves, but Jennifer Riester countered with a 6-2, 3-6, 6-1 win at #6 to put Northwestern back on top.
With the #1 position going the way of the Owls, the match came down to Sydney Pratt at #5. After splitting the first two sets with Rice's Nithesa Selvaraj, Pratt booked a dominant 6-1 win in the final set to clinch victory for herself and for the 'Cats.
With ITA Kickoff Weekend behind them, Northwestern will next hit the courts on Sunday, Feb. 4, when they'll face off with Georgia Tech in Atlanta. First serve of that match is scheduled for 11 a.m. CT.
